Cairo (CAI) to Munich (MUC)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Cairo International Airport (CAI) in Cairo, Egypt to Munich International Airport (MUC) in Munich, Germany is 2,623 kilometers (1,630 miles / 1,416 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 4h, flying northwest at a heading of 326°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is an international route connecting Egypt with Germany. It is an intercontinental flight between Africa and Europe.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 09:07 in Cairo, it's 08:07 in Munich.

There is a significant elevation difference of 1,105 feet between the two airports. Munich International Airport sits higher than Cairo International Airport.

The return flight from Munich (MUC) to Cairo (CAI) follows a heading of 133° (southeast).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
